In the Begining

To say I have amassed quite a fabric collection would be the understatement of the century. Four years ago I went to IKEA and bought this book shelf unit (in brown-black) and realized that it was not big enough, so I added the desk and the larger book shelf and turned my little dining area into a sewing nook. That's a total of 41 cubbies, all filled with banker's boxes full of fabric. At the end of 2012, I had to add another 8 cubbie shelf and still ended up with 15 banker's boxes worth of fabric in my storage. This is not to mention the laundry basket and Billy Book Shelf that hold the bolts of fabric and 6 rolls.

For 2013 I'm dedicating myself to putting a dent in this fabric stash. I figure the best way to this is to journal as I dive in. So you get to come along with me on this journey.
